#898EA3 Hex color

#898EA3

The hexadecimal color code #898EA3 corresponds to the code RGB( 137, 142, 163 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,54 level), green (at 0,56 level) and blue (at 0,64 level). Its brightness is 58% and its saturation is 12%. It is composed of red at 30%, green at 32% and blue at 36%.
